                        Originally posted by dubya_rx View Post
                        How much of this is hand entered?

                        Looks like my heats 1 and 2 are combined for event #7.
                        None of it is hand entered, heats were combined because a new session wasn't started while timing was running. Typical process is to start a new session with each run in the afternoon, it was accidentally missed. One enhancement I'm looking at for next year is a way to correct this after the event through the UI.

                        I *could* manually fix the data, but it would be a few hours of manual data manipulation and as far as I could find there isn't anyone with two heats combined that had their best time in one heat and 2WO or 4WO in the other that was combined. No real ROI for the time and risk.

                            Originally posted by dubya_rx View Post
                            How much of this is hand entered?

                            Looks like my heats 1 and 2 are combined for event #7.
                            This was my bad and will be noted in Timer's notes once we post results.

                            I was still catching up on something before Chris released the next group and forgot to initiate a new session to demarcate the new heat. As soon as that run for that group was done, I quickly initiated a new session which is why others show Heat #2 properly. Since no one went 2WO or 4WO, I did not ask Will to spend the time to manually split the runs. This maintains data integrity including my error for audit purposes. This is why I keep timer's notes published as of 2019.

                            Only thing hand entered is your transponder ID number and no... not the seven digit number but the two digit hand mark one plus PI values and miscellaneous driver info (name, car, model, year, etc.).

                            I purposely restricted manual entry as much as possible in the new software directive so it minimizes vectors for human error. If your time shown is weird, its just a matter of connecting two dots created by MyLaps with no possible way of manual editing.
